Understanding the Basics of Forex Spreads

Before diving into CBCX Markets' model, it's essential to understand what forex spreads are and why they matter. A spread is the difference between the buying (bid) price and the selling (ask) price of a currency pair. Traders pay attention to spreads because they directly affect profitability—narrower spreads mean lower trading costs and potentially higher returns. CBCX Markets' Unique Approach

CBCX Markets distinguishes itself by adopting a dynamic pricing strategy that adjusts to market conditions in real-time. Unlike some traditional brokers who offer fixed spreads, CBCX Markets provides variable spreads that can fluctuate based on liquidity and volatility. This approach allows traders to benefit from tighter spreads during periods of high liquidity while still having the flexibility to trade even when markets are less stable. Challenges and Considerations

While CBCX Markets' pricing model offers numerous benefits, there are challenges to consider. Variable spreads can sometimes lead to wider gaps during periods of low liquidity, which might not be ideal for all trading styles.
